Hey all, I'm traveling on a domestic flight in a couple of days. I have the portable magnetic go board from YMI that I'd like to take along to study on the trip, and I'm worried about security issues. I believe magnets are banned carry-on luggage, but maybe weak magnets aren't? I'm traveling on a company's dime, so I won't be able to check in any luggage. So, my question is, has anyone here had any experience with magnetic boards with regards to TSA? I'm worried what the scanner person is going to think, seeing a magnetic mat and two clumps of smaller magnets.

Don't know if this matters, but I'm planning on stuffing the roll-up board and stones into my backpack for carry-on.

I too can confirm minor trouble in Europe - when going with your carry on through the screen every magnet shows up, tightly cramped in their box.

So at least when you place your carry on the screening machine take the board out and show it to them in advance. Remember everybody knows chess, "magnetic board for a game similar to chess" is much better than "magnetic go board" - "go where?????".

No experience out of Europe, sorry.
